The Impact of Electronic Medical Records on the Process of Care: Alignment with Complexity and Clinical Focus

Xin (David) Ding et al.

Summary: This study examines the impacts of electronic medical records (EMR) on hospital performance. The findings indicate that advanced stages of EMR can help mitigate hospital complexity and improve the process of care. Additionally, clinical focus can substitute for lower stages of EMR and complement higher stages of EMR in mitigating the potential negative impacts of complexity on the process of care.

Economies of Scale and Scope in Hospitals: An Empirical Study of Volume Spillovers

Michael Freeman et al.

Summary: This study examines the impact of volume changes on the costs of different services in general hospitals. It found that increased elective surgery volume is associated with higher costs of emergency care, but increased emergency activities in one specialty can lead to lower costs of emergency care in other specialties. There were no spillover effects across specialties for elective admissions.
